SEOUL, July 12 (Yonhap) -- Group BTS’s first solo J-HOPE’s pre-released song “More” entered Billboard main single chart “Hot 100.”

J-HOPE’s “More” entered “Hot 100” chart at No.82, announced official SNS of Billboard chart on Monday(local time).

J-HOPE previously ranked No.81 with “Chicken Noodle Soup” in 2019.

“MORE” is an old school hip-hop genre song in which J-HOPE sings his hope to show diverse aspects of himself to the world using his unique shouting technique. This song entered UK official singles chart at No.70.

J-HOPE is releasing all songs of his first solo album “Jack In The Box” including “More” on Friday.
